WebMar 8, 2015 · As you want all 4 digit combinations of 0 to 9, 0000 will also be accounted. for (int i=0; i<=9999; i++) { if (i<10) { System.out.println ("000"+i); } else if (i<100) { … WebMar 28, 2024 · In order to count four digit numbers not beginning with 0 with no repeating digits, proceed one digit at a time. There are 9 possibilities for the first digit. Since the second digit must be distinct, there are 10 − 1 = 9 possibilities. For the third digit, we have 10 − 2 = 8 possibilities, and for the fourth, we have 7. WebJun 17, 2024 · This is because there are 10 choices for each of the 4 digits (0-9). First method: If you count from 0001 to 9999, that's 9999 numbers. Then you add 0000, which makes it 10,000. Second method: 4 digits means each digit can contain 0-9 (10 combinations). The first digit has 10 combinations, the second 10, the third 10, the fourth 10. So 10*10*10*10=10,000. smalls kershaw sc
